WebMay 6, 2024 · Stock Splits. A stock split occurs when a company increases its total shares by dividing up the ones it currently has. This is typically done on a two-to-one ratio. 5. For example, you might own 100 shares of a stock priced at $80 per share. You'd have 200 shares priced at $40 each if there were a stock split.
